Dr. Sarah Adamo offers a PhD position on immunological memory within the group of Prof. Mascha Binder. Dr. Adamo's research focuses on the study of human B and T cell memory in the context of infection, vaccination and cancer. Research in the Binder group addresses translational aspects in immuno-oncology, with a strong focus on improving immunotherapy and develop novel targeted antibody-based and cellular treatment approaches for hematological and solid cancers.
Your position
The successful candidate will have the opportunity to work with cutting-edge experimental methods, including CRISPR-Cas9, single-cell RNA and ATAC sequencing, advanced high-parameter flow-cytometry, as well as murine models and human organoid technology to investigate mechanisms of longevity of immunological T and B cell memory.
A strong interest in quantitative disciplines, willingness to work with animal (mouse) models, and excellent teamwork and communication skills in English are required. The PhD candidate will be expected to take an active role in shaping the project, supported by Dr. Adamo and close collaboration partners, within an environment that encourages academic freedom and scientific independence.

Your main tasks will be:
- Establishing models of B and T cell priming in human lymphoid organoids.
- Performing characterization of organoids and primary samples with flow cytometry and single cell sequencing approaches.
- Analysing and visualizing high-dimensional data.
- Engineering of T cell receptors with CRISPR-Cas9.
- Testing B and T cell priming conditions in organoids and mouse models of infection.
- Support and preparation of scientific reports and journal articles.
